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.07.18;
Скачать: CL | DM;

Вниз

Установка и запуск проги   Найти похожие ветки 

 
Jann ©   (2004-07-01 13:26) [0]

Я не волшебник я только учусь!
А как сделать так, чтобы при запуске программы путь (местонахождения программы) автоматически поподал в AdsConnection.ConnectPath???


 
Ega23 ©   (2004-07-01 13:35) [1]

AdsConnection.ConnectPath???   - Это что????

как сделать так, чтобы при запуске программы путь (местонахождения программы) автоматически поподал в

Я думаю, что прописывать его в ...


 
Axis_of_Evil ©   (2004-07-01 13:39) [2]

AdsConnection.ConnectPath := GetParamStr(0);
вместо GetParamStr можно еще API функции использовать,
но я их не помню


 
Ega23 ©   (2004-07-01 13:41) [3]

Достаточно просто ParamStr(0).


 
Jann ©   (2004-07-01 13:41) [4]

А откуда возьмем GetParamStr(0)


 
Ega23 ©   (2004-07-01 13:43) [5]

А откуда возьмем GetParamStr(0)

Боюсь, что ниоткуда. Просто ParamStr(0).


 
Amoeba ©   (2004-07-01 13:44) [6]


> А откуда возьмем GetParamStr(0)

F1

RTFM


 
Axis_of_Evil ©   (2004-07-01 13:44) [7]

2Ega23 ©   (01.07.04 13:41) [3]
>Достаточно просто ParamStr(0).
мдя, правильно, без компилятора под рукой я нынче никуда:>
2Jann
AdsConnection.ConnectPath := ParamStr(0);


 
Iconka   (2004-07-01 14:01) [8]

А можно и Application.ExeName


 
Jann ©   (2004-07-01 14:08) [9]

Попробовал AdsConnection.ConnectPath := ParamStr(0) ничего не получилось, а надо чтобы после отработки setup.exe этой программы в произвольный каталог и дальнейшего запуска программы в AdsConnection.ConnectPath попал тот произвольный путь. Привели бы пример кода для FormCreate!!!


 
Iconka   (2004-07-01 14:19) [10]

Тогда уж
AdsConnection.ConnectPath:= ExtractFileDir(Application.ExeName)


 
Плохиш ©   (2004-07-01 14:20) [11]


> Jann ©   (01.07.04 14:08) [9]

AdsConnection.ConnectPath := ExtractFilePath(ParamStr(0)) + ADSDatabaseName;


 
Iconka   (2004-07-01 14:22) [12]

Какая разница между ExtractFileDir и ExtractFilePath?


 
Iconka   (2004-07-01 14:23) [13]

Там случаем не надо вставить "\":

AdsConnection.ConnectPath := ExtractFilePath(ParamStr(0)) + "\" + ADSDatabaseName;


 
BillyJeans   (2004-07-01 14:33) [14]

2 Iconka   (01.07.04 14:22) [12]

Вот тем самым "\" и отличаются...


 
Iconka   (2004-07-01 14:34) [15]

Ясненько


 
Jann ©   (2004-07-01 14:55) [16]

Всем спасибо за дебаты!
Все получилось!
Особенная благодарность "Iconka"!!!!!



Страницы: 1 вся ветка

Текущий архив: 2004.07.18;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.023 c
3-1087874804
SnapIn
2004-06-22 07:26
2004.07.18
Непонятная ошибка в MSSQL......


14-1088197597
Anatoly Podgoretsky
2004-06-26 01:06
2004.07.18
Веселая сегодня пятница


14-1088267506
andreytha@nm.ru
2004-06-26 20:31
2004.07.18
Как стать сертифицированым специалистом за 5 минут


1-1088794348
AndreyZ
2004-07-02 22:52
2004.07.18
Tedit, TMemo


3-1087345149
Смертник
2004-06-16 04:19
2004.07.18
Помогите пожалуйста с DBGrid.